Kortelainen et. al. designed a bed sensor system with multi-channel non-contacting pressure electrodes for sleep monitoring using pressure sensors [10]. Their ultimate goal was to extract heart rate and respiration signal from patients using sliding time window algorithms. Their approach was mainly focused on signal calculation and processing and not on hardware and showed inadequate performance when tested on patients with arrhythmia.
